Gatekeeper
Status
Displays the current status of connection to
Gatekeeper.
- Unregistration : Indicates ‘no-connection’.
- Registration : Indicates ‘connection’.
1
RAS Method
Selects manual to connect to the Gatekeeper or not
according to the Prefix, and selects Auto for the rest of
the case.
2
Registration
Type
Sets the registration type for Gateway when it
registered to Gatekeeper. The types include E.164 ID
of Gateway mode and Caller ID in the Caller ID Table.
3
Gatekeeper
Type
Specifies the manufacturer of Gatekeeper.
0. SIGK : Select if Samsung Internet Gatekeeper is to
be connected.
1. Other GK : Select if other company’s Gatekeeper is
to be connected.
4
GW Routing
In GK mode
This sets which routing table will be used.
0. Disable : To use only the routing table set in the
Gatekeeper select this.
1. Enable : To use both a routing table set in the
Gatekeeper and a routing table set in the
SMG-400 select this.
5
Gatekeeper IP
Sets IP address of the Gatekeeper to be connected.
6
Gatekeeper
Alias
Sets H.323 Alias Name of the Gatekeeper to be
connected.
7
Alternative
Gatekeeper IP
When Gatekeeper is to be duplicated, and the
connection to the primary Gatekeeper is disconnected,
it sets the other Gatekeeper’s IP address.
8
Gatekeeper
Down Option
Sets the type of routing that may be used in case the
connection to the Gatekeeper in use becomes
disconnected.
0. Alternative GK : Connects to the alternative
Gatekeeper set in the above item 4.
1. PSTN : Uses PSTN routing.
